&lt;H1 id="toc-hId-412963124" class="lia-message-subject"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="lia-link-navigation blog-article-link lia-link-disabled"&gt;How much bandwidth does an Arlo camera use when it is capturing video?&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/H1&gt;
&lt;DIV class="lia-message-body lia-component-body"&gt;
&lt;DIV class="lia-message-body-content"&gt;
&lt;DIV class="lia-message-template-content-zone"&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;Each camera uses a different amount of bandwidth based on its video resolution settings. To learn how much bandwidth your Arlo system uses, add the streaming cameras’ bandwidth settings together. If a camera detects low bandwidth, the Arlo system automatically reduces the video stream settings to accommodate lower bandwidth.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;Note: The listed values are approximations.&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Arlo Wire-Free Camera&lt;/STRONG&gt;:&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;UL&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Best Video&lt;/STRONG&gt;. 700-750 kilobits per second (kbps)&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Optimized&lt;/STRONG&gt;. 450-550 kbps&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Best Battery Life&lt;/STRONG&gt;. 300 kbps&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;/UL&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Arlo Q and Arlo Q Plus&lt;/STRONG&gt;:&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;UL&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;1080P&lt;/STRONG&gt;. 1500 kbps&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;720P&lt;/STRONG&gt;. 700 kbps&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;480P&lt;/STRONG&gt;. 300 kbps&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;360P&lt;/STRONG&gt;. 200 kbps&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;&lt;FONT size="3"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;240P&lt;/STRONG&gt;. 100 kbps&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;/UL&gt;
